Model drift: a critical challenge for AI performance in production

Zakaria Benhadi

·

Founding Engineer

at Basalt

7min

·

Nov 11, 2025

Introduction

The rapid deployment of large language models (LLMs) in production environments is reshaping the way businesses and users interact with AI-driven services. However, this transformation introduces significant challenges related to reliability, security, and quality assurance. Continuous monitoring of LLMs has become essential for maintaining system performance, detecting behavioral drifts, and ensuring an optimal user experience.

Why monitor LLMs in production?

1. Detecting drifts and regressions

LLMs, while powerful, are inherently dynamic and may exhibit changing behaviors over time. They can start producing less relevant responses, unintentionally introduce biases, or demonstrate unexpected patterns. Continuous monitoring is crucial to quickly identify these drifts before they negatively impact users or tarnish the organization's reputation. Moreover, after deploying updates or configuration changes, LLMs may suffer performance regressions, manifesting as decreased response quality or slower processing times. Active monitoring facilitates rapid detection of such regressions, enabling teams to restore optimal performance swiftly.

2. Maintaining consistent quality

Continuous oversight ensures that LLM responses remain coherent, accurate, and aligned with business objectives and regulatory requirements. Monitoring tools also help identify security vulnerabilities, hallucinations, or non-compliant outputs, protecting both users and organizations from potential harm. Furthermore, insights gathered through monitoring feed into iterative improvement loops, allowing for prompt refinement of prompts, model parameters, or guardrails. This process sustains high service quality and compliance over time.

How to effectively monitor LLMs in production

1. Selecting the right metrics

Effective monitoring hinges on choosing metrics that capture key aspects of LLM behavior and system health. These include user feedback scores reflecting perceived response quality, error rates quantifying inaccurate or incomplete outputs, response latency indicating processing speed, token usage patterns to detect inefficiencies or abuse, and comprehensive logs that document interactions for troubleshooting. Together, these metrics provide a multidimensional view of model performance and user experience.

2. Implementing advanced observability

Observability extends beyond basic monitoring by offering deep visibility into inputs, outputs, internal model states, and system-level metrics. This holistic insight allows teams to understand not only what issues arise but why they occur. Request tracing is a critical component, tracking each query's path from ingestion to final output, which aids in diagnosing faults and optimizing workflows.

3. Automating detection and response

Automation is vital for scaling monitoring efforts. Real-time alerts can notify teams immediately upon detecting behavioral drifts, error spikes, or latency issues. Feedback loops integrating both user evaluations and automated assessments enable prompt remediation of identified problems. Additionally, systematic regression and adversarial testing verify that model updates do not introduce new vulnerabilities or degrade performance, maintaining robust and resilient AI services.

4. Leveraging specialized tools

Several dedicated platforms, such as Basalt, offer tailored dashboards, real-time analytics, and LLM-specific metrics designed for comprehensive observability.

Challenges and best practices

Monitoring LLMs poses unique difficulties due to their non-deterministic nature, requiring a blend of quantitative metrics and qualitative evaluation to fully capture model behavior. Data privacy and security must be safeguarded when handling logs and monitored information. Additionally, monitoring frameworks need continuous adaptation to evolving ethical standards and regulatory mandates governing AI deployment.

Conclusion

Continuous monitoring of LLMs in production is indispensable for anticipating drifts, preserving consistent quality, and fostering trust in AI applications. By combining well-chosen indicators, advanced observability techniques, automated detection mechanisms, and specialized monitoring tools, organizations can ensure the robustness, security, and compliance of their language models. This comprehensive approach not only mitigates risks but also supports agile adaptation in a rapidly evolving AI landscape.

Unlock your next AI milestone with Basalt

Get a personalized demo and see how Basalt improves your AI quality end-to-end.
Product Hunt Badge